France's role in the Ukraine conflict remains pivotal as it continues to articulate a firm stance against Russia's strategic maneuvers. French leaders, such as Ambassador Vessier and Minister Haddad, emphasize the importance of maintaining a militarily strong Ukraine to ensure security. Ambassador Vessier criticizes Russia's tactics as delaying peace, while Haddad firmly rejects any peace agreement that involves Ukraine's demilitarization, labeling it unacceptable. Additionally, France actively participates in bolstering Ukraine's military infrastructure and its integration into the European market. With Macron and other French officials advocating for diplomatic resolutions and economic sanctions against Russia, France confirms its unwavering support for Ukraine. This dedication is complemented by France's participation in international collaborations aiming to counteract Russian aggression, including joint cybersecurity operations with Ukrainian and European partners. As tensions persist, France remains a poignant supporter of Ukrainian sovereignty and European stability.

What is France's position on the demilitarization of Ukraine?

France holds a firm position against the demilitarization of Ukraine, asserting that it is crucial for the country to maintain its military capabilities to ensure its own security and stability. The French government has labeled any peace agreement requiring Ukrainian demilitarization as unacceptable, emphasizing the need for Ukraine to be empowered in the face of ongoing threats.

How does France contribute to Ukraine's military strength?

France has been actively supporting Ukraine's military through various means, including financial allocations, the provision of military equipment, and facilitating defense industry collaborations. France aims to strengthen Ukraine's armed forces to better withstand aggression and ensure the country's territorial integrity, demonstrating a commitment to a fortified European security landscape.

What diplomatic actions has France taken regarding the Ukraine conflict?

France has taken multiple diplomatic actions to address the Ukraine conflict. This includes participating in international negotiations, advocating for stronger sanctions against Russia, and emphasizing the importance of maintaining Ukraine's sovereignty. French leaders frequently engage in discussions with Ukrainian and other European officials to align efforts and propose strategic measures aimed at achieving a peaceful resolution.

What is France's stance on Russia's negotiation proposals?

French officials, including Ambassador Vessier, view Russia's negotiation proposals as tactical delays aimed at avoiding a peaceful resolution. France insists on genuine commitments from Russia to engage constructively in the peace process. The French government continues to push for diplomatic efforts that are anchored in real action rather than rhetorical gestures.

How does France support Ukraine's integration with the EU?

France supports Ukraine's integration with the European Union by providing financial assistance for reconstruction projects and encouraging Ukraine's alignment with European standards. French officials have pledged significant funds specifically targeted at facilitating Ukraine's economic integration and development, which are viewed as essential steps in strengthening Ukraine's ties with the EU.

What role does France play in European cybersecurity concerning Ukraine?

France actively participates in collaborative cybersecurity efforts with Ukrainian and European partners to combat malicious activities originating from actor groups linked to Russia. This includes operations coordinated with Europol and other law enforcement agencies, highlighting France's focus on securing its digital infrastructure and assisting allies against cyber threats.

How does France view its relationship with NATO amid the Ukraine conflict?

France perceives the Ukraine conflict as a strategic threat to both European stability and NATO cohesion, opposing Russian attempts to weaken the alliance. By reinforcing its defense partnerships and advocating for a united front within NATO, France underscores its commitment to collective security measures and ongoing support for Ukraine as a critical aspect of regional stability.
